The smartphone industry in 2025 shows clear maturation. Top manufacturers have moved beyond simply increasing specs—they’re now optimizing for specific user experiences. Apple continues to dominate the premium segment with its A-series chips and tight ecosystem integration. Samsung maintains its position as the Android leader with the versatile Galaxy S series and innovative foldables. Google has carved out a significant niche with computational photography and clean software experience through Pixel devices.
What separates the best phones from the rest in 2025 comes down to three factors: processing power that handles AI tasks efficiently, camera systems that perform consistently across lighting conditions, and battery life that comfortably lasts a full day under heavy use. The phones that excel in all three areas while maintaining reasonable price points earn their place at the top of our recommendations.
Price stratification has also evolved. The premium flagship category starts around $1,000 and can exceed $1,800 for top-spec models. Mid-range phones now deliver 80-90% of flagship performance at 50-60% of the cost, typically priced between $400-700. Budget options under $400 have improved dramatically, though they require compromises in camera quality and processing power.
Samsung’s Galaxy S25 Ultra stands as the most complete Android phone available in 2025. The device balances productivity features with entertainment capabilities better than any competitor, making it the top recommendation for users who want one device to handle everything.

The S25 Ultra excels in versatility. The S Pen stylus integrated into the device appeals to note-takers and creative professionals. The 200MP camera captures remarkable detail, though the real improvement comes from Samsung’s AI processing—photos look consistently excellent without requiring manual adjustments. The large 6.9-inch display provides ample screen real estate for productivity tasks while remaining manageable for most users.
Battery life proves competitive with the best in class. In testing, the S25 Ultra consistently lasts a full day with heavy use including streaming, navigation, and camera usage. The 45W charging capability means you can reach 50% battery in approximately 20 minutes when you need a quick top-up.
One consideration: the phone’s large size and premium materials make it heavier than average. Users with smaller hands or those preferring compact devices may want to consider the standard S25 or S25+ instead.
For users committed to the Apple ecosystem or those who prioritize seamless integration with other Apple products, the iPhone 16 Pro Max represents the pinnacle of iOS devices available in 2025.

The iPhone 16 Pro Max delivers Apple’s best overall package. The A18 Pro chip handles everything from casual browsing to intensive mobile gaming with remarkable efficiency. Apple’s computational photography continues to set the standard—the 48MP main camera produces images with excellent dynamic range and color accuracy, particularly in challenging lighting conditions.
iOS remains a significant differentiator for many users. The operating system feels refined and receives consistent updates for five or more years, protecting your investment. Integration with iCloud, AirPods, Apple Watch, and Mac devices creates a seamless experience that Android competitors struggle to match.
Battery life has improved substantially over previous generations. The 16 Pro Max comfortably lasts through a full day of heavy usage, addressing what was historically one of Apple’s weaknesses. The 30W charging is adequate, though not the fastest available—Samsung and Chinese manufacturers offer quicker charging speeds.
Google’s Pixel 9 Pro XL continues the company’s tradition of delivering the best smartphone camera experience through computational photography rather than simply increasing megapixel counts.

The Pixel 9 Pro XL produces images that rival—and sometimes exceed—devices with more impressive hardware specifications. Google’s AI-powered features like Magic Eraser, Best Take, and Add Me provide genuine utility rather than gimmicky additions. The 50MP main sensor captures excellent detail, while the 5x telephoto lens maintains quality at zoomed distances.
Software experience represents another significant advantage. Google delivers the purest Android experience with timely updates and no bloatware. The Pixel-exclusive features, including Pixel Studio for image generation and improved Gemini integration, add meaningful functionality.
The Tensor G4 processor, while not matching raw performance of Qualcomm’s Snapdragon 8 Elite in benchmark tests, handles everyday tasks smoothly and excels at AI-dependent features. Battery life matches the competition—expect a full day of use with moderate to heavy usage.
Foldable phones have matured significantly, and the Samsung Galaxy Z Fold 6 represents the most refined option for users who want tablet-level productivity in a phone-sized form factor.

The Z Fold 6 addresses previous criticisms while maintaining the unique value proposition of a foldable. The improved hinge design creates a nearly invisible crease, and the device feels more durable than earlier iterations. Samsung claims enhanced durability with better protection against dust and debris.
Using the large internal display transforms productivity. Running multiple apps side-by-side becomes genuinely practical, and the S Pen support (with a separate case) enables note-taking and drawing. For users who frequently consume content or work on their phones, the expanded screen real estate provides meaningful benefit.
The tradeoffs include higher cost, heavier weight compared to standard phones, and charging speed that trails competitors. The camera system, while improved, doesn’t match the best traditional flagships. These compromises make sense for users who value the foldable form factor but may disappoint those expecting traditional flagship performance in a novel package.
Not everyone needs—or wants to pay for—the most expensive flagship. The Google Pixel 9a demonstrates that excellent smartphone experiences don’t require premium prices.

The Pixel 9a delivers approximately 85% of what the Pixel 9 Pro offers at less than half the price. The camera system, while not matching the Pro model’s capabilities, produces impressive results for everyday photography. The processing power handles social media, streaming, messaging, and light gaming without issues.
Software updates remain a significant advantage. Google promises seven years of OS updates, matching flagships and dramatically exceeding other budget options. This means the Pixel 9a remains secure and current through the early 2030s.
The compromises include slower charging (18W), less impressive build materials, and a processor that shows its limits with intensive tasks. For users who prioritize value and software experience over raw performance, the Pixel 9a represents an exceptional choice.
| Feature | Galaxy S25 Ultra | iPhone 16 Pro Max | Pixel 9 Pro XL | Z Fold 6 | Pixel 9a |
|---|---|---|---|---|---|
| Starting Price | $1,299 | $1,199 | $999 | $1,899 | $499 |
| Display Size | 6.9″ | 6.9″ | 6.8″ | 7.6″ | 6.3″ |
| Main Camera | 200MP | 48MP | 50MP | 50MP | 48MP |
| Battery | 5,000mAh | 4,685mAh | 5,060mAh | 4,400mAh | 5,100mAh |
| Charging | 45W | 30W | 45W | 25W | 18W |
| Best For | All-around power | iOS ecosystem | Camera quality | Foldable productivity | Budget value |
Before making your final decision, evaluate these factors based on your personal priorities:
Operating System Preference: If you’ve invested in Apple’s ecosystem with a Mac, iPad, or Apple Watch, sticking with iPhone minimizes friction. Similarly, Android offers better integration with Windows PCs and Google services. Switching ecosystems means accepting a learning curve and potentially losing purchased content like apps and media.
Camera Priorities: All five recommendations take excellent photos, but they excel in different scenarios. The Pixel 9 Pro XL handles low-light situations most gracefully. Samsung’s S25 Ultra offers the most versatile zoom range. Apple’s portrait mode remains industry-leading. Consider which types of photography matter most to you.
Future-Proofing: All recommended devices will receive software updates for five or more years. If keeping your phone for four or five years matters, prioritize devices with proven update longevity—Pixel and iPhone currently lead in this regard.
Form Factor Preferences: The choices range from compact (Pixel 9a) to massive (Z Fold 6). Visit a store to hold each option if possible. Larger screens offer better experiences for media and productivity but require compromises in portability.
The Samsung Galaxy S25 Ultra and Google Pixel 9 Pro XL currently offer the best battery life among flagship devices, consistently lasting a full day under heavy use. The Pixel 9a also excels in this category relative to its price, thanks to its efficient processor and large 5,100mAh battery.
If your current phone is still functional, waiting for fall 2025 releases makes sense. However, current-generation devices like the S25 Ultra and iPhone 16 Pro Max will remain excellent choices, and new models typically launch at premium prices. Buying now means enjoying your device immediately while saving money compared to early adoption of the latest generation.
Foldable phones like the Galaxy Z Fold 6 cost significantly more than traditional flagships. They make sense for users who genuinely utilize the larger internal display for productivity, multitasking, or content consumption. If you’d primarily use the external screen, a traditional flagship offers better value.
Samsung promises seven years of OS updates for the S25 series. Apple typically supports iPhones for five to six years. Google offers seven years for Pixel devices. Budget phones from other manufacturers often receive only two to three years of updates—research this factor carefully if keeping your phone long-term matters to you.
The Samsung Galaxy S25 Ultra and iPhone 16 Pro Max both handle the most demanding mobile games at highest settings. Both feature processors that won’t become outdated for several years, and their displays support high refresh rates for smooth gameplay. The large batteries in both devices also support extended gaming sessions.
Most users don’t need 1TB of storage. 256GB suffices for typical usage including apps, photos, and some video. 512GB makes sense for users who record lots of video, download many large games, or maintain extensive offline media libraries. 1TB represents overkill for nearly all consumers unless you’re storing significant amounts of 4K video locally.
